RERA-registered real estate agency

Working with a RERA-registered agency is essential to ensure legal certainty. Only real estate companies registered with the Real Estate Regulatory Authority (RERA) are officially permitted to operate in the Dubai rental market. They not only assist in selecting suitable tenants but also ensure that all processes are handled legally and professionally.

Rental Price Determination

During an initial inspection, we obtain all the necessary property information to determine a market-based rental price for a sustainable and satisfactory tenancy.

These documents are required and must be provided by the owner: the title deed, a copy of the passport, an Emirates ID card or a valid residence visa, and DEWA account details. If the property is mortgaged, a recent bank statement and a copy of the mortgage document must also be submitted.

Property Listing approval

Before a property in Dubai can officially be offered for rent, a listing permit is required. This permit authorizes the property to be advertised through a real estate company registered with RERA.

To apply for this permit with the Dubai Land Department (DLD), the following documents must be submitted:

  • Title Deed
  • Copy of the owner's passport
  • Signed Listing Agreement

Typically, the appointed real estate agent handles the submission and completion of this process on behalf of the owner.

RERA Rental Agreement

After selecting the tenant, conducting a credit check, and carefully drafting the RERA Unified Tenancy Contract (RERA Unified Tenancy Contract), which defines the rights and obligations of both parties, the tenancy agreement can be successfully concluded in one optimally prepared meeting.

Ejari Registration

Ejari is the official registration system for rental agreements in Dubai, managed by the Dubai Land Department. Every rental agreement must be registered through Ejari to be legally recognized. Registration protects both landlords and tenants and is a prerequisite for activating utility services such as DEWA. It can be done online or through authorized service centers.

Payment Terms

Upon signing the lease, the tenant is obligated to make the agreed payments to the landlord. This typically includes a security deposit of 5% of the annual rent for unfurnished properties or 10% for furnished properties, as well as any advance payments due.

The rent can be paid either in full in a lump sum (single check) or as an initial payment with additional, post-dated checks deposited for the remaining installments - depending on the individual agreement.

  • Checks for Rent Payments
  • Checks Payments

If the tenant and landlord agree to pay the annual rent in several installments, the tenant is obligated to provide the appropriately dated checks upon signing the lease.

A post-dated check is a payment instrument issued for a future date. The bank will not cash this check until the specified date; earlier cashing will be refused by the bank. This procedure is common practice in Dubai to ensure regular rental payments.

Utility Connections

To ensure the tenant can use the property smoothly, all necessary utility contracts - especially for electricity, water, and gas - should be activated in a timely manner. After registering the lease through Ejari, the Dubai Electricity and Water Authority (DEWA) will set up an account for the tenant and send the login details via email.

The following documents are required for activation:

  • Property's DEWA number
  • Passport copies of tenant and landlord
  • Completed DEWA form
  • Title deed extract
  • Activation fee of AED 130
  • A refundable security deposit

Any outstanding utility bills must be paid before moving in to ensure proper service.

Documented handover

After all payments have been made, the property will be handed over to the new tenant along with all keys, access devices for the building, parking garage, or leisure facilities, and a handover protocol, which must be signed by all parties.

Only after this confirmation can the tenant officially move into the property.
